
拓海先生、最近部下から「バッチで学習する安全な強化学習」って論文の話を聞きまして、現場に導入できるか心配でして。要するに現場のデータで安全にAIを改善できる方法という理解で合っていますか。

素晴らしい着眼点ですね!大筋はその通りです。今回紹介する手法は、過去に収集した動作データだけから方策を改善する際に、評価のぶれ(Q値の誤差)を考慮して安全性を保ちながら改善する方法です。大丈夫、一緒にやれば必ずできますよ。

過去のデータだけで、ですか。うちの現場で言うと、記録された操作ログからロボットの制御方針を直すイメージでしょうか。データが不足していると、逆に悪化するリスクがあると聞きましたが。

まさにその懸念が中心課題です。ここで重要なのは、Q値というのは「その行動を選んだら将来どれだけ得するかの見積もり」です。この見積もりはデータが少ない行動ほど不確かで、誤差が大きくなります。だから急に確率を上げると、誤差に引っ張られて性能が下がることがあるんです。

これって要するに、希少な行動に対して急に賭けると「見積りミスで大損する可能性がある」ということですか。

その通りですよ。素晴らしい着眼点ですね!この論文は3点に要約できます。まず、Q値の推定誤差を考慮して方策の変化量を制限すること。次に、その制約を満たす最適な方策を状態ごとに直接求めること。そして最後に、その非パラメトリックな解をネットワークに模倣させて学習することです。

非パラメトリックというと、つまり方策を直接数値で作ってから学習させるという理解でいいですか。現場への導入コストはどの程度でしょう。

良い質問ですね。要点を3つで説明します。1つ目、実装は既存のQ学習やポリシー学習の上に乗せられるため大きな仕組み変更は不要です。2つ目、デプロイ前に方策を安定化させる時間が必要で、模倣学習の工程が入ります。3つ目、投資対効果は改善の速さと安全性で回収できますが、初期評価は慎重に行うべきです。

投資対効果の話が出ましたが、具体的にはどの場面で効果が出やすいですか。うちのラインだと例外的な稼働が少ないためデータ偏りは心配です。

偏りがある現場ほど効果が出やすいです。理由は、頻繁に現れる行動はデータが豊富で評価が安定しているため、そこでの改善は安全かつ即効性があります。一方で希少な挙動は制約で急な変更を抑えられるので、初期のリスクを低減できます。大丈夫、一緒に順序立てて進めれば可能です。

実務的な導入手順を教えてください。パイロットの段取りや評価指標の設定で、現場が混乱しないようにしたいのです。

順序立てましょう。まず現行方策のログを集めバッチを作ること。次にRBI(Rerouted Behavior Improvement)の制約で安全に改善した方策を生成し、その方策をシミュレーションや限定環境で試験すること。最後に、改善の効果を性能指標と安全指標で比較して段階的に本番へ展開します。大丈夫、段階的に進めれば必ずできますよ。

なるほど。最後に確認ですが、これを導入すると現場の事故リスクが減るという理解でよろしいですか。コストがかかるならその理由を明確にしたいのです。

はい、その理解で問題ありません。要点を3つにまとめます。1) 即時の大幅改善よりも安全で着実な改善を優先するため事故リスクを低減できる。2) データ効率が高まる局面があり、学習に掛かるコストを抑えられる可能性がある。3) 初期導入には評価や模倣学習の工数が必要だが、長期的には事故や誤動作の回避で投資回収が期待できるのです。

分かりました。自分の言葉で言うと、「過去データから方策を改良する際に、データの少ない選択肢には急に賭けずに、まず安全な改善を優先してから段階的に学習させる方法」という理解でよろしいですね。

その通りです!素晴らしいまとめです。大丈夫、一緒に計画を立てて進めれば、現場でも安全に効果を出せるんですよ。
1.概要と位置づけ
結論を先に述べる。本研究は強化学習(Reinforcement Learning, RL)における方策改善の過程で発生する評価誤差に起因する危険を抑えつつ、データ効率よく性能を引き上げる手法を示した点で画期的である。特に、既存の経験バッチのみを用いる「バッチ強化学習(Batch Reinforcement Learning, Batch RL)」の場面で、方策の急激な変化に伴う性能悪化を数学的に抑制する制約を導入した点が本質的な貢献である。このアプローチは、リアルワールドの自動運転や製造ラインの自動化といった安全性が重要な応用先で直ちに意味を持つ。
従来、方策改善はQ値の推定に依存し、推定誤差により期待通りの改善が得られないリスクがあった。批判的な視点を先に挙げると、既存のグリーディーな改善法や一部の制約付き最適化手法は、この誤差を十分に扱えず負の改善(performance degradation)を招く可能性がある。そこで本手法は、方策の変更量を行動ごとのサンプリング頻度に応じて抑制する「reroute(リルート)」という新たな制約を導入した。
ビジネス視点での位置づけは明瞭だ。本手法は既存の学習パイプラインに大幅な設計変更を求めず、方策改善の安全性を高めることで導入リスクを低減する。特に、初期のパフォーマンスが極めて重要な運用環境では、短期的な安定性確保と長期的な改善速度の両立が経営判断上の価値を生む。従って、本論文は研究者だけでなく実務家にとっても直接的な示唆を与える。
本手法の核心は、Q値推定の不確実さを明示的に制御項に組み込む設計思想である。これは単なるトリックではなく、不確実性の度合いに応じて行動確率の変化を抑えるという合理的な安全保証手法であり、実務上のリスク管理フレームワークに馴染みやすい。
最後に実務への示唆を付記する。短期的には限定環境での模倣学習や段階的デプロイを組み合わせることで、導入コストを抑えつつ安全性を担保できるという方針が現実的である。これは、現場での段階的導入を好む日本企業の文化にも適合する手法である。
2.先行研究との差別化ポイント
先行研究では、方策最適化の際にしばしばKLダイバージェンス(Kullback–Leibler divergence, KL)やトラストリージョン(Trust Region)といった全体的な距離制約を用いる例が多い。これらは方策全体の変化を抑えることで安全性を確保する手法だが、行動ごとのサンプリング頻度の差を十分に反映できない弱点がある。結果として、希少だが重要な行動の評価誤差により局所的な破綻が起こり得る。
本研究が差別化する点は、行動別のサンプリング頻度を直接的に反映する「改善ペナルティ(improvement penalty)」の分散解析に基づいて制約を定式化したことである。この解析により、改善ペナルティの分散が|β(a|s)−π(a|s)|^2/β(a|s)に比例することが示され、そこで生じるリスクを抑えるためのreroute制約が生み出される。
さらに技術的な差異として、本手法は各状態ごとに非パラメトリックな最適化(線形計画問題)を解いて方策を導出する点が挙げられる。これはパラメータ空間での勾配法に頼らず、状態単位で安全性を確保する明示的な解を得るアプローチで、解釈性と制御性に優れる。
実務的インパクトの違いも重要である。従来法は大規模なデータや長時間のオンライン学習を前提とする場合が多いが、本手法は既存の過去バッチデータのみでも安全に改善を試みられるため、運用開始前の評価で有効に機能する。すなわち、導入コストとリスクのバランスが現実的に改善される。
この差別化は、特に安全性が最優先される領域での受容性を高める要因となる。既存のパイプラインを大幅に変えずに、安全性を高めたい経営判断には直接的な価値提案となる。
3.中核となる技術的要素
本研究の技術的中核は三つある。第一にQ値の推定誤差を定量的に扱う理論解析であり、そこから改善ペナルティの分散が行動ごとのサンプリング頻度に逆比例する形で増幅することを導く点である。第二にその解析を受けて導入される「reroute」という制約であり、この制約は|β(a|s)−π(a|s)|^2/β(a|s)の増大を抑える役割を果たす。
第三に実装面での工夫として、各状態ごとに非パラメトリックな最適化問題を解き、得られた方策をニューラルネットワークで模倣学習する二段構えの学習パイプラインを採用している点が挙げられる。具体的には、アクターが状態に対して安全な方策を計算し、それをパラメータ化した学習者がKLダイバージェンスを損失として模倣する。
理論的に重要なのは、この手順が局所的なQ値の誤差に敏感に反応し、サンプリングが少ない行動については変更を抑えることで漸進的な改善に留める点である。これにより、誤って希少行動を過剰に強化してしまうリスクを根本から低減する構造が成立する。
実務における解釈としては、rerouteは「行動ごとの信用度に応じて投資額を調整するリスク管理ルール」に相当する。言い換えれば、確度の低い提案には段階的投資を行い、確度が高まるにつれて投資を拡大する意思決定ルールを学習アルゴリズムに組み込む方式である。
4.有効性の検証方法と成果
検証は理論解析と実験の両輪で行われている。理論面では改善ペナルティの分散解析により、改善失敗の確率を抑制する効果が示された。実験面では二腕バンディット問題や標準的なベンチマーク環境で、RBI(Rerouted Behavior Improvement)がグリーディー法や他の制約付き手法に比べてデータ効率と最終性能の両面で優れることが示されている。
特に二腕バンディットのガウス報酬設定では、サンプリング頻度の差が大きい状況においてRBIが顕著に有利であり、希少行動に起因する重大な性能低下を避けつつ、より短いデータ量で良好な方策に到達できると報告されている。これが示すのは、リアルワールドの偏ったデータ分布下での有用性である。
実装面では、アクターが非パラメトリック最適化を解き、学習者がそれを模倣するサイクルを繰り返す運用を示した点が実務的に重要だ。この手法はシミュレーションや限定的な現場テストで段階的に検証でき、理想的な導入パスを描きやすい。
結果の解釈としては、RBIは単なる安全策ではなく、誤った過信による改善失敗を回避することで長期的な学習効率を高めるという点が評価できる。短期的な劇的改善を狙うよりも、総合的なリターンを安定して実現する道筋を示す。
一方で成果の外挿については慎重を要する。実験は制御された環境下で行われており、実際の産業現場での運用ではログの品質や環境非定常性が追加の課題となるため、パイロット検証は不可欠である。
5.研究を巡る議論と課題
まず理論的課題として、Q値推定の誤差モデルが単純化されている点が挙げられる。本研究は独立同分布(i.i.d.)サンプリングの仮定の下で解析を行っているが、実環境のログはしばしば時間依存性やバイアスを含むため、解析の厳密性をそのまま実運用に持ち込むことは注意を要する。
次に実装上の課題として、各状態で非パラメトリック最適化を解く計算コストと、模倣学習によるパラメータ更新の収束性がある。これらは大規模な状態空間や連続行動空間では実装上のボトルネックになり得るため、近似手法や効率化が求められる。
さらに、評価指標の設定も議論の的である。安全性をどの程度確保するかは業務により許容値が異なるため、経営判断に基づく閾値設定や、万が一の性能低下を検出するための監視体制整備が必須である。これを怠ると安全策が運用上の負担となる可能性がある。
倫理的観点からは、方策改善に伴う責任所在の明確化が必要だ。例えば改善によって生じた不具合の原因が学習過程にあるのかデータ収集にあるのかを追跡可能にするログと説明性が要求される。ここは経営的なルール設計と技術的な可視化の両面で対応すべき課題である。
最後に現場適応の課題を挙げる。限られたデータ資源のもとで安全性と効率を両立させるためには、段階的なA/Bテストや限定デプロイの運用ルールが不可欠であり、これらは技術導入の前に明文化しておくべきである。
6.今後の調査・学習の方向性
今後の研究は三つの方向性が重要である。第一に、時間依存性やバイアスを含むより現実的なデータ生成プロセス下での理論解析を進めることだ。これによりRBIの保証が現場データにも適用可能かどうかを確認できる。第二に、大規模状態空間や連続行動空間での計算効率化手法の開発である。近似アルゴリズムや経験リプレイの戦略が鍵を握る。
第三に、経営層が意思決定しやすい形での可視化と評価指標の整備である。改善の安全性や期待値の変動を定量的に提示できるダッシュボードの整備は、導入の合意形成を容易にする。これらは技術開発だけでなく組織的なプロセス整備を含む。
学習面では、模倣学習とオンライン微調整のハイブリッド戦略が有望である。初期はバッチでRBIにより安定化させ、その後限定的にオンラインで探索を許容することで、長期的性能の改善と安全性の両立が期待される。実務ではこの段階的運用が現実的である。
産業応用の観点からは、自動運転や医療、重機制御などの安全性重視領域で実証実験を行い、RBIの効果と運用上の課題を洗い出すことが重要だ。これにより学術的貢献だけでなく実務的な導入手引きが整備される。
最後に、経営層への提案としては、まずは小さな範囲でのパイロット導入を行い、効果とコストを定量評価した上で段階的に拡大する方針が現実的である。これにより投資対効果を明確にし、安全性を担保しつつ技術導入を進められる。
検索に使える英語キーワード
会議で使えるフレーズ集
- 「過去ログのみで方策改善を試みる際の安全弁としてrerouteを採用しましょう」
- 「初期は限定環境で模倣学習し、安全性を確認してから本番展開します」
- 「希少な行動に対する急激な確率変更はリスクなので段階的に行います」
- 「投資回収は事故低減と学習効率の改善で期待できます」


